Gluten-free flour mix has a glycemic index of 80, which classifies it as a high GI food. With a glycemic load of 68 per 100g, it has a significant impact on blood sugar.

Compared to other grains, Gluten-free flour mix ranks among the highest in glycemic index.

Gluten-free flour mix may cause rapid blood sugar spikes and is best consumed in small portions.

Nutrition Facts (per 100g)

Calories360 kcal
Carbohydrates85g
Sugars (Total)1g
Natural1.0g
Added0g
Fiber2g
Soluble0.6g
Insoluble1.4g
Protein2g
Fat0.8g
Saturated0.2g
Unsaturated0.6g
Sodium5mg

Is Gluten-free flour mix good for people with insulin resistance?

Gluten-free flour mix has a high glycemic index (80), which means it causes rapid blood sugar spikes. People with insulin resistance should limit their intake or combine it with low-GI foods.

How does Gluten-free flour mix affect blood sugar?

Gluten-free flour mix has a glycemic load of 68 per 100g, which indicates a significant impact on blood sugar levels. The glycemic load accounts for both the quality and quantity of carbohydrates.
